Abstract
A very bright white organic light-emitting diode (OLED) was realized by using a bright blue-emitting layer, 1,7-diphenyl-4-biphenyl-3,5-dimethyl-1,7-dihydrodipyrazolo[3,4-b;4′,3′-e]pyridine (PAP-Ph), together with a 4-(dicyanomethylene)-2-methyl-6-(4-dimethylaminostyry)-4H-pyran (DCM)-doped Alq [tris(8-hydroxyquinolinato) aluminum (III)] layer to provide blue, red, and green emission for color mixing. By appropriately controlling the layer thickness, the white light OLED achieved good performance of 24 700 cd/m2 at 15 V, 1.93 lm/W at 6.5 V, and >300 cd/m2 at 7.7 mA/cm2. The Commission Internationale de l’Eclairage coordinates of the emitted light are quite stable at voltages from 6 to 12 V, ranging from (0.35, 0.34) to (0.34, 0.35).Keywords
